蓝桉云顶

Good Luck To You!

如何有效管理和优化CDN节点以应对高负荷情况?

CDN节点负荷是指内容分发网络中,各节点服务器在处理用户请求时所承受的工作量和压力。

CDN(内容分发网络)节点的负荷管理是确保网站高效运行和用户体验优化的重要环节,以下是关于CDN节点负荷的详细分析:

一、CDN节点负荷

CDN节点负荷指的是在特定时间段内,CDN节点所承受的访问请求量、数据传输量以及处理这些请求所需的计算资源等,高负荷可能导致节点响应速度下降,甚至服务中断,因此有效的负荷管理至关重要。

二、影响CDN节点负荷的因素

1、用户访问量:网站的受欢迎程度、访问高峰期等因素都会影响CDN节点的负荷,电商平台在促销期间可能会迎来大量用户访问,导致CDN节点负荷激增。

2、内容类型(如图片、视频)和动态内容(如实时交互、数据库查询)对CDN节点的负荷影响不同,静态内容通常更容易缓存,而动态内容则需要更多的计算资源来处理。

3、地理位置:用户与CDN节点之间的物理距离也会影响负荷,离用户更近的节点通常会承担更多的访问请求。

4、网络状况:网络带宽、延迟等因素也会影响CDN节点的负荷,网络拥堵或不稳定可能导致请求传输时间延长,增加节点的处理负担。

三、CDN节点负荷管理策略

1、智能调度:通过DNS负载均衡技术,根据用户的地理位置、网络状况等因素,将用户请求智能地分配到最近的、负载最低的CDN节点上,这有助于均衡各节点的负荷,提高整体服务效率。

2、缓存优化:合理设置缓存策略,将频繁访问的内容缓存到CDN节点上,减少源服务器的压力,定期更新缓存内容,确保用户获取到最新的数据。

3、扩容与缩容:根据业务需求和用户访问量的变化,动态调整CDN节点的数量和规模,在访问高峰期,可以增加节点数量以提高处理能力;在低谷期,则可以减少节点以节约成本。

4、监控与预警:建立完善的监控体系,实时监测CDN节点的负荷情况,一旦发现节点过载或即将过载,立即触发预警机制,并采取相应的应对措施。

四、CDN节点负荷监控与分析工具

为了更有效地管理CDN节点负荷,可以使用各种监控与分析工具,这些工具可以帮助管理员实时了解节点的运行状态、访问量、响应时间等关键指标,并生成详细的分析报告,通过这些报告,管理员可以识别出性能瓶颈、优化空间以及潜在的风险点,从而制定更加科学合理的负荷管理策略。

五、案例分析

以某大型电商平台为例,该平台在全国部署了多个CDN节点以应对海量用户的访问需求,在促销活动期间,平台通过智能调度系统将用户请求均匀分配到各个节点上,避免了单一节点过载的问题,平台还利用缓存优化技术减少了源服务器的压力,提高了整体服务的响应速度和稳定性,平台还建立了完善的监控体系,实时监测各节点的运行状态和负荷情况,确保在出现问题时能够及时响应并处理。

六、常见问题解答

问:CDN节点是否会因为爬虫访问而产生额外负荷?

答:不会,CDN节点无法区分正常用户访问还是爬虫访问,因此爬虫访问不会直接增加CDN节点的负荷,如果爬虫频繁访问导致源服务器压力增大,间接可能会影响到CDN节点的性能表现,建议对爬虫访问进行合理控制和管理。

问:如何评估CDN节点的负荷承载能力?

答:评估CDN节点的负荷承载能力需要考虑多个因素,包括节点的硬件配置、网络带宽、存储容量以及处理能力等,还需要结合历史访问数据和业务发展趋势进行预测和分析,通过综合评估这些因素,可以确定节点的最大承载能力和潜在的优化空间。

七、小编有话说

随着互联网技术的不断发展和用户需求的日益多样化,CDN节点的负荷管理面临着越来越多的挑战和机遇,作为网站运维人员或开发者我们需要不断学习和掌握新的技术和方法来应对这些挑战并抓住机遇推动网站性能和用户体验的持续提升,同时我们也需要注意保持对新技术和新趋势的关注以便及时调整和优化我们的策略和方法以适应不断变化的市场环境。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2025年1月    »
12345
6789101112
13141516171819
20212223242526
2728293031
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
文章归档
网站收藏
友情链接